Transaction 59bdf79115c7fd564a47769956a5b85864b9fe04e8530ac3daa0e81a8f7002ef
1 Input
1 Output
-
59bdf79115c7fd564a47769956a5b85864b9fe04e8530ac3daa0e81a8f7002ef:0
- value
- 374593
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cdacf5a9db2e7d3081e693d9a2bd1a31399d4feb OP_EQUAL
- address
- 3LSXeKBVKQU7HRXGKsazbibE9EmZoTAnWq